NTMY is a slang abbreviation for “Nice To Meet You.” It’s commonly used in text messages, online chats, gaming conversations, dating apps, and social media when meeting someone for the first time.
In some cases, people use it as a quicker alternative to typing the full phrase, especially during fast-moving conversations.
Example:
“Hey, I’m Jake from California.”
“NTMY! I’m Emma.”

Emotional Meaning & Tone
NTMY usually carries a friendly and welcoming tone.
It’s often used to create a positive first impression and show politeness during introductions.
Friendly
Most common use.
“NTMY! Looking forward to chatting.”
Neutral
Sometimes it simply acknowledges an introduction.
“NTMY.”
Rude
NTMY itself isn’t rude.
However, if used alone without any additional response, it can occasionally feel cold or uninterested.
Example:
Person: “Hi, I’m Alex.”
Response: “NTMY.”
While not offensive, it may seem brief.

Is NTMY Rude or Safe to Use?
NTMY is completely safe and polite to use.
It’s considered a friendly internet abbreviation and is widely accepted across most platforms.
Safe Situations
- First-time introductions
- Gaming communities
- Social media chats
- Dating apps
- Online groups
When to Avoid It
In formal business emails or professional communication, writing the full phrase:
“Nice to meet you”
is usually more appropriate.

Common Mistakes & Misunderstandings
Thinking It Has a Hidden Meaning
Some people assume NTMY is flirting or signaling romantic interest.
Most of the time, it’s simply a polite greeting.
Using It in Formal Emails
Business communication usually requires the full phrase.
Overusing It
Once is enough during introductions.
Repeatedly using NTMY can sound unnatural.
Confusing It With Other Acronyms
NTMY is sometimes mistaken for gaming or technical abbreviations, but in texting it almost always means “Nice To Meet You.”
